Global Connections invites legendary Venezuelan artist Oscar D'León for a conversation with Berklee students. Known as the "Pharaoh of Salsa,” D'León was named Best Salsa Artist at the 2014 Venezuela Music Awards, and has had a successful touring and recording career spanning 50 years. Join us for this conversation in which D'León shares his compelling stories about his musical journey. 

This session is made possible by generous support of Berklee Latino and Latin Music Studies at Berklee. It will be hosted by student Camila Cortina and Oscar Stagnaro, professor of bass, executive director of Berklee Latino, and Latin Music Studies faculty advisor.
